Handover note — Reception, Guest Wi-Fi Desk

Hi Tomasz, taking over from me on the guest Wi-Fi desk at Arborlane House reception: vouchers are in the left drawer, printed in batches of twenty, and the tablet for sign-ins charges under the counter. Log every visitor before issuing a voucher. If you need to open the supplies cupboard behind the desk, use the pass code below.

staff pass of kagup-fajog = bdg-QCHVQW-99665837

Subject: Dark-mode cut-over done

New folks — the Cindergate admin dashboard now defaults to the dark theme. Cut-over finished last night; legacy stylesheet is gone, theme tokens live in the Varrow service. No user complaints so far. If a page looks wrong, check the token cache before filing anything. The theme service ships with the following configuration.

service settings:
[oliix]
team = noveth
access_code = ac_4de949
host = oliix.novachq.corp
port = 8080
owner = wenir.casion
peer = wenys.lumicstack.corp

# EXIF scrub fixture for Pixelgrove's upload pipeline.
# Input images carry fake GPS, serial, and lens tags; the scrubber
# (Tagwipe v3) must strip all of them but keep orientation.
# Assertions check byte-level absence of the tag IDs, not just
# library output — Tagwipe has lied to us before.
# Contractor note: regenerate fixtures with make fixtures, never
# by hand, or checksums drift. The scrub service rejects anonymous
# calls, so the fixture sends the bearer token below.

login token, bagug-kafop: eyJhbGciOiJIUzI1NiIsInR5cCI6IkpXVCJ9.eyJzdWIiOiIcMLov2In0.Z5RLDIfp

**Q: What happens when Mailcull marks a bounce as permanent?**

Mailcull, our email bounce processor, classifies hard bounces after three consecutive failures and suppresses the address automatically. Soft bounces are retried for 72 hours. If the suppression list itself becomes corrupted, restore it from the encrypted nightly snapshot in the Thornfield backup bucket. Restoring requires the team recovery passphrase, which is kept directly below this entry for emergencies.

unlock words, kahof-bahap: praax-ulaix